Output 4090e28823f1cbcbcf592e2582a04fea4e918f90d8a37278dc5fe7c56fc1a34f:0

value
16315727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a6f6980701fc342d99cc51420c80db058d13581 OP_EQUAL
address
3FmbT8nyJyF8JBJ9uXT1bEh3JbRwgYsJqU
transaction
4090e28823f1cbcbcf592e2582a04fea4e918f90d8a37278dc5fe7c56fc1a34f
confirmations
374042
spent
true